Subject: Handover — Coldpath release signing

Hi,

Before you review the Coldpath changes, note that our serverless handlers now pre-warm via the Fennick scheduler, cutting cold starts roughly in half. The warm-pool config ships with each release bundle, so every deploy must be signed or the scheduler rejects it. Please verify signatures against the key below.

signing key of baduf-kafog = bky6_Azw6Lf

Onboarding: LiftSim, Carroway Labs' elevator-dispatch simulator. Review dispatch logic in the scheduler module first; car-state transitions are the usual bug source. Tests must pass deterministically with the fixed seed. To decrypt the shared fixtures bundle before your first review, use the recovery passphrase that follows.

strongbox words: eliius-pelath-sorius-oliys-noviel

## Support

If TilePloy starts prefetching the wrong zoom levels or hammering the upstream tile cache, don't panic — it usually just needs a config reload. Check the prefetch queue depth first; anything over 50k is suspicious. Still stuck after a restart? The Maplight team is happy to help, so drop them a line.

escalation mailbox, bafog-fafog: ulador@paliqlabs.internal